Integrative medicine combines evidence-based complementary medicine with standard internal medicine practices to produce holistic care models. Internists can include nutrition counseling, mindfulness, yoga, or acupuncture to treat patients with chronic disease, pain, or stress-related disorders.
This patient-centered model enables people to be active participants in their healing journey. Integrative medicine builds the therapeutic relationship and improves outcomes in general and internal medicine practice by treating both body and mind.
